bada wrote:It happened in the Convergence event.

https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Convergence_(comics)

Basically Brainiac collected cities from various dead realities and one of them had the Pre-52/Flashpoint Superman/Lois and their son. At the end of the event they were able to escape into the current prime Earth.
Im glad i didnt read that...seems exhausting. So Superman is our old superman who fought with doomsday and died right? and then came back?

Yes he's our old Superman and you were right to skip Convergence.

I always recommend Hickman's Fantastic Four run.

F4 vol 1 #570-574
F4 vol 2 #575-578
F4 vol 3 #579-582
F4 vol 4 #583-588
FF vol 1 #1-5
FF vol 2 #6-11
F4 vol 5 #600-604
FF vol 3 #12-16 (events take place during F4 vol 5)
FF vol 4 #17-23
F4 vol 6 #605.1, 605-611
